Let n be a natural number such that the remainder of the division of 4294 by n is 10, and the remainder of the division of 3521 by n is 11. what is n?

4294 - 10 = 4284 and 3521 - 11 = 3510. The common factors of 4284 and 3510 are 18, 9, 6, 3, and 2. The problems that work are 18 because only with 18 do the remainders work out. Therefore n = 18
